Cette procédure fait appel à l'assistant de configuration clsetup pour HA pour Oracle Database avec Oracle ASM pour gérer le stockage de données.
Cet assistant Oracle Solaris Cluster Manager requiert que tous les nœuds du cluster aient le même mot de passe root.
Avant de commencer
Assurez-vous que les conditions suivantes sont remplies :
Le gestionnaire de volumes du cluster est configuré pour fournir des volumes sur le stockage partagé, accessibles depuis n'importe quel noeud Oracle Solaris Cluster où Oracle Database peut être potentiellement exécuté.
Les périphériques bruts et les systèmes de fichiers requis pour la base de données Oracle Database ont été créés sur les volumes de stockage.
Le logiciel Oracle Database est installé et accessible depuis tous les noeuds sur lesquels Oracle Database peut être exécuté.
Les variables de noyau du système d'exploitation UNIX sont configurées pour Oracle Database.
Le logiciel Oracle Database est configuré pour tous les noeuds sur lesquels il est possible d'exécuter Oracle Database.
Les packages de services de données sont installés.
Une entrée est ajoutée à la base de données de service de noms pour chaque nom d'hôte logique auquel la ressource doit pouvoir accéder.
Si vous prévoyez d'utiliser un listener SCAN Oracle Grid Infrastructure, l'adresse IP de celui-ci appartiendra au même sous-réseau que l'adresse IP du nom d'hôte logique que vous utiliserez pour la ressource Oracle Database. Sinon, la ressource Oracle Database ne basculera pas en cas de défaillance du réseau public.
Si vous utilisez des objets PNM, ceux-ci sont configurés sur les nœuds à partir desquels il est possible de mettre en ligne la ressource de nom d'hôte logique. Les objets PNM (gestion de réseau public) comprennent les groupes IPMP (fonctionnalité de chemins d'accès multiples sur réseau IP), les groupements de jonctions et les groupements de liaisons DLMP, ainsi que les VNIC soutenus directement par des groupements de liaisons.
Tout projet créé pour exécuter l'une et/ou l'autre des applications suivantes existe dans la base de données de services de noms projects de l'utilisateur qui exécute l'application :
Oracle Database
Oracle ASM
Si aucun projet personnalisé n'est créé pour une application, le projet par défaut est utilisé. Pour plus d'informations, voir la page de manuel projects(1).
Assurez-vous que vous disposez des informations suivantes :
Les noms des noeuds de cluster qui commandent le service de données.
Le chemin vers les fichiers binaires d'application Oracle Database pour les ressources que vous prévoyez de configurer.
Le type de base de données.
# clsetup
Le menu principal de clsetup s'affiche.
Le menu Services de données s'affiche.
L'utilitaire clsetup affiche une liste des conditions requises pour effectuer cette tâche.
L'utilitaire clsetup vous invite à sélectionner l'emplacement de Oracle Database, le cluster global ou un cluster de zones.
Sélectionnez le cluster global ou un cluster de zones. L'utilitaire clsetup affiche une liste de composants HA pour Oracle Database à configurer.
L'utilitaire clsetup affiche une liste des noeuds du cluster.
Assurez-vous que les noeuds sélectionnés sont répertoriés dans l'ordre dans lequel ils apparaissent dans la liste de noeuds du groupe de ressources de structure HA pour Oracle Database.
Lorsque cela s'avère nécessaire pour terminer la sélection de nœuds, saisissez d. L'utilitaire clsetup affiche une liste des ressources d'instance Oracle ASM.
Si aucune instance de ressource Oracle ASM n'est disponible et si le système vous invite à créer une ressource, appuyez sur la touche Entrée. Passez à l'Step 11.
L'utilitaire clsetup affiche l'écran de sélection pour le répertoire d'accueil d'Oracle Grid Infrastructure.
L'utilitaire clsetup vous invite à indiquer le projet à utiliser.
Si vous n'avez pas créé un projet où Oracle ASM doit s'exécuter, sélectionnez le projet par défaut. L'utilitaire clsetup affiche la liste des identificateurs système (SID) Oracle ASM découverts dans le cluster.
L'utilitaire clsetup affiche des informations relatives aux ressources de groupe de disques Oracle ASM.
L'utilitaire clsetup affiche une liste des groupes de disques Oracle ASM existants. Passez à l'Step 15.
L'utilitaire clsetup affiche une liste des ressources de stockage découvertes. Passez à l'Step 17.
Saisissez le numéro d'option correspondant à chaque groupe de disques à utiliser. Quand tous les groupes de disques sont sélectionnés, saisissez d.
Les groupes de disques Oracle ASM sélectionnés sont ajoutés au panneau de sélection des ressources de groupe de disques Oracle ASM.
Lorsque la liste des ressources de groupes de disques est correcte, saisissez d.
L'utilitaire clsetup affiche une liste des ressources de stockage découvertes.
L'utilitaire clsetup créera une nouvelle ressource une fois la configuration d'Oracle ASM terminée.
L'utilitaire clsetup affiche une liste des ressources de groupe de disques Oracle ASM qui gèrent les groupes de disques Oracle ASM.
L'utilitaire clsetup détecte les groupes de disques Oracle ASM.
L'utilitaire clsetup vous renvoie à la liste des ressources de groupe de disques Oracle ASM. La ressource que vous avez créée est ajoutée à la liste.
Vous pouvez sélectionner des ressources existantes, des ressources qui ne sont pas encore créées ou indiquer une combinaison de ressources existantes et de nouvelles ressources. Si vous sélectionnez plusieurs ressources existantes, les ressources sélectionnées doivent se trouver dans le même groupe de ressources.
L'utilitaire clsetup affiche la liste des ensembles de disques sous-jacents ou des groupes de disques découverts.
L'utilitaire clsetup affiche les noms des objets Oracle Solaris Cluster pour Oracle ASM qu'il va créer ou ajouter à votre configuration.
Assurez-vous que les noeuds de cluster sont répertoriés dans l'ordre dans lequel ils apparaissent dans la liste des noeuds du groupe de ressources dans lequel se trouvera la ressource Oracle Database.
S'il y a lieu, pour confirmer votre sélection de nœuds de cluster, saisissez d.
L'utilitaire clsetup affiche les types de composant Oracle Database que vous pouvez configurer.
Vous pouvez sélectionner le serveur, le processus d'écoute, ou les deux.
L'utilitaire clsetup répertorie le chemin d'accès au répertoire d'accueil Oracle Database.
L'utilitaire clsetup vous invite à indiquer le répertoire d'accueil Oracle Database.
L'utilitaire clsetup vous invite à indiquer le projet à utiliser.
Si vous n'avez pas créé un projet où Oracle Database doit s'exécuter, sélectionnez le projet par défaut. L'utilitaire clsetup vous invite à indiquer l'identificateur système (SID) de Oracle Database pour votre installation de Oracle Database.
L'utilitaire clsetup affiche les propriétés des ressources Oracle Solaris Cluster qu'il va créer.
L'utilitaire clsetup vous invite à saisir le SID.
L'utilitaire clsetup affiche les propriétés des ressources Oracle Solaris Cluster qu'il va créer.
L'utilitaire clsetup affiche les propriétés des ressources Oracle Solaris Cluster qu'il va créer.
L'utilitaire clsetup affiche un écran dans lequel vous pouvez spécifier le nouveau nom.
L'utilitaire clsetup vous renvoie à la liste des propriétés de la ressource Oracle Solaris Cluster qu'il va créer.
L'utilitaire clsetup vous ramène à la sélection du stockage pour Oracle Database.
L'utilitaire clsetup répertorie toutes les ressources de stockage hautement disponibles configurées.
L'utilitaire clsetup affiche une liste des ressources d'instance Oracle ASM.
L'utilitaire clsetup affiche la liste des ressources de nom d'hôte logique disponibles.
A l'invite, saisissez le nom d'hôte logique à utiliser.
Passez à l'Step 34.
Passez à l'Step 35.
L'utilitaire clsetup affiche les noms des ressources de nom d'hôte logique Oracle Solaris Cluster à sélectionner.
L'utilitaire clsetup affiche les numéros des ressources de nom d'hôte logique que vous avez sélectionnées.
L'utilitaire clsetup affiche les noms des objets Oracle Solaris Cluster qu'il va créer.
L'utilitaire clsetup affiche un écran dans lequel vous pouvez spécifier le nouveau nom.
L'utilitaire clsetup vous renvoie à la liste des noms des objets Oracle Solaris Cluster qu'il va créer.
L'utilitaire clsetup affiche un message de progression pour indiquer que l'utilitaire exécute des commandes pour créer la configuration. Une fois la configuration terminée, l'utilitaire clsetup affiche les commandes que l'utilitaire a exécutées pour créer la configuration.
Si vous préférez, vous pouvez laisser l'utilitaire clsetup en cours d'exécution pendant que vous effectuez d'autres tâches avant d'utiliser l'utilitaire à nouveau.